在ROS系統中連線Astra Mini系列攝像機

2021-09-12 15:17:16 字數 1183 閱讀 1101

執行環境: ubuntu16.04 + ros kinetic kame

建立乙個 catkin_ws 工作空間(參考installing and configuring your ros environment).

進行攝像機配置(參考camera configuration)

安裝 libuvc 和 libuvc-ros 功能包

$ sudo apt-get install ros-kinetic-libuvc

$ sudo apt-get install ros-kinetic-libuvc-ros

在命令列中輸入如下命令:

$ sudo apt-get install ros-kinetic-astra-camera ros-kinetic-astra-launch

(這行命令不知道是否要執行,為了保險起見還是執行一下吧.)

$ cd catkin_ws/src/ros_astra_camera

$ sudo ./install.sh # 如果出錯嘗試 "sudo sh ./install.sh"

$ cd catkin_ws

$ catkin_make --pkg astra_camera # 編譯可能會出現錯誤,但是好像不影響

$ roslaunch astra_launch astra.launch # 建立連線

連線成功後會出現如下資訊:

6. 開啟乙個新終端,更新一下環境源,開啟image_view.

ROS 1 在zsh中安裝ros

參考 ros install wiki 平台 ubuntu 14.04 64bit ros 版本 indigo sudo apt key adv keyserver hkp sks keyservers.net 80 recv key 421c365bd9ff1f717815a3895523baee...

在ubuntu20 04中安裝ROS系統詳解

在ubuntu20.04 16.04中安裝ros系統詳解 20.04中安裝ros ubuntu16.04 現 error cannot download default sources list from ubuntu安裝ros進行到rosdep update時出現錯誤,如error unable ...

ROS學習(七)使用Rosed在ROS中編輯檔案

rosed是rosbash套件的一部分。它允許您通過使用包名稱直接編輯包中的檔案,而不必鍵入包的完整路徑。用法 rosed package name filename 這樣,您可以輕鬆地檢視和選擇編輯程式包中的所有檔案,而無需知道其確切名稱。用法 rosed package name 例子 rose...